Pakistan secured a comfortable 57-run victory against Zimbabwe in the opening Twenty20 international of a three-match series. The match took place on Sunday in Bulawayo.Pakistan, aiming for a white-ball double after winning the ODI series 2-1, chose to bat first after winning the toss. They posted a total of 165-4. (Zimbabwe Cricket Photo) NEW DELHI: Kamran Ghulam slammed his first one-day international hundred as Pakistan defeated Zimbabwe by 99 runs in Bulawayo on Thursday, clinching the series 2-1.His innings of 103 contributed to Pakistan’s total of 303-6 in 50 overs at Queens Sports Club. Pakistan leveled the three-match ODI series against Zimbabwe with a resounding 10-wicket victory at Queens Sports Club on Tuesday.
